A “datasheet” is essentially a technical document that summarizes the performance and other technical characteristics of a component, assembly, or subsystem (e.g., in electronics) in sufficient detail to allow a design engineer to integrate the component into an application. The C1111 8p Datasheet, specifically, outlines the key attributes of a networking device, often a router or a similar piece of equipment. These devices are crucial for connecting different networks and directing data traffic. Inside C1111 8p Datasheet you can find the following:
- Power requirements
- Operating temperatures
- Network interface types
The C1111 8p Datasheet plays a vital role in network design and implementation. Imagine planning a large-scale network for a business. Without a datasheet, you wouldn’t know the device’s limitations or its compatible interfaces. This could lead to misconfigured networks, performance bottlenecks, or even equipment failure. The datasheet ensures that you can choose the right device for the right application and integrate it seamlessly into your existing infrastructure. Furthermore, it helps in troubleshooting issues by providing detailed information about the device’s behavior under different conditions.
